Adapting Remote High-Intensity Resistance Exercise and Sleep Monitoring in Parkinson's Disease

This study is exploring a new way to deliver high-intensity resistance exercise (rHIRE) to people with Parkinson's disease (PD) from their homes. We know that exercise helps manage PD symptoms, but getting to exercise programs can be tough. This study aims to adapt an exercise program that previously improved sleep in people with PD, making it available remotely. Researchers will also test how easy it is to use a device that monitors sleep from home. You might be able to join if you live in Colorado, have a PD diagnosis, need little help at home, and have internet and a video-capable device. Success in this study means that the remote exercise program is acceptable and that the sleep monitoring device is usable. What's involved
Participants will complete 5 upper and lower extremity resistance exercises for 10 repetitions for 3 sets, with additional body weight exercises in between sets. Acceptability and usability will be measured through surveys and interviews within one week after the exercise intervention.

Eligibility criteria

Inclusion

Currently residing in Colorado, USA
PD diagnosis per Movement Disorders Society Diagnostic Criteria
Requiring less than minimal assistance at home
Having internet access
Having a video-capable device

Exclusion

Uncontrolled cardiovascular disease or pulmonary disease
Musculoskeletal injuries
Participation in Parkinson's Disease community exercise programs more than 3 days a week
Contraindication to physical activity as determined by the Physical Activity Readiness Questionnaire (PAR-Q)
Fall risk defined by requiring \>20 seconds to complete the 5 times sit to stand test14 or high frequency of falls within the past year (≥ one fall per month)
Virtual Montreal Cognitive Assessment (MoCA) score ≥ 18 (performed at the eligibility visit)
